Candies, fudge, chocolate, with nuts,… vs. Candies, NESTLE, BUTTERFINGER Bar vs. Candies, CARAMELLO Candy Bar

Side-by-side comparison of nutrient values per 100g edible portion, sourced directly from the U.S. Department of Agriculture's FoodData Central (FDC) - SR Legacy reference foods and FDC Foundation foods (April 2026 release). Each value reflects USDA's standardized laboratory analysis methodology under USDA data-documentation methodology.

Candies, CARAMELLO Candy Bar has the most protein of the foods compared, at 6.2 g per 100g.

Nutrient Candies, fudge, chocolate, with nuts,… Candies, NESTLE, BUTTERFINGER Bar Candies, CARAMELLO Candy Bar
Protein 4.4 G5.4 G6.2 G
Total lipid (fat) 18.9 G18.9 G21.2 G
Carbohydrate, by difference 68.2 G72.9 G63.8 G
Energy 460 KCAL459 KCAL462 KCAL
Total Sugars 63.4 G45.9 G56.9 G
Fiber, total dietary 2.5 G2 G1.2 G
Calcium, Ca 57 MG36 MG213 MG
Iron, Fe 2 MG0.79 MG1.1 MG
Potassium, K 183 MG220 MG341 MG
Sodium, Na 39 MG230 MG122 MG
Vitamin D (D2 + D3), International Units 0 IU0 IU-
Cholesterol 12 MG0 MG27 MG
Fatty acids, total trans 0.14 G0.04 G-
Fatty acids, total saturated 6.5 G9.5 G12.7 G
